function setCreateOutputs()

in src/handler.ts [179:197]


function setCreateOutputs(
  config: ActionConfig,
  outputs?: Record<string, unknown>,
) {
  if (!outputs) {
    return;
  }

  for (const key of Object.keys(outputs)) {
    const output = outputs[key] as { value: string };
    setOutput(key, output.value);
    if (
      config.maskedOutputs &&
      config.maskedOutputs.some(x => x.toLowerCase() === key.toLowerCase())
    ) {
      setSecret(output.value);
    }
  }
}